Simulating the Residual Layer Thickness in Roll-to-Plate Nanoimprinting with Tensioned Webs

Roll-to-plate nanoimprinting with flexible stamps is a fabrication method to pattern large-area substrates with micro- and nanotextures. The imprint consists of the preferred texture on top of a residual layer, of which the thickness and uniformity is critical for many applications. In this work, a...
